"Wish you were here"
Been on the road now 3 weeks, all is travelling well. I've had some fun, some dramas, and some laughs along the way. It's wonderful to see your own country, nothing like what I was expecting. Only had a few mishaps, one being a foot infection day 4 into my big trip. Got held up for 2 days for the swelling to go down so i could drive. It was from a mozzie bite, so now I have become the mozzie repellent queen and no mozzie would get within a 20 metre radius of my campsite! The other drama was a blown tyre in Kakadu, but I am happy to say i can successfully change a truck tyre! So I think I am doing quite well!

It's funny, yes it's a big country, but it really doesn't feel like it. You drive along and the towns roll on, you keep meeting up with the same people, you see the same cars everywhere. i should have started a 'wicked' campervan count... i would be in triple figures by now. No but honestly, it feels like a small country.

It's been hot, really hot. Not so bad when there is a nice croc-free waterhole to swim in, but at night in a stuffy van, it's hot! I must admit, I am alittle sleep deprived at the moment, so please excuse me if this doesn't make any sense.

So anyway i hope you like the pictures, get to see what i am up to anyway. It might all seem abit backwards cause I only just got the travel blog set up here in Darwin. I have tried to keep it in some sort of order but it doesn't matter. I know you are intelligent people and you will work it out!

My favourite places so far have been Lawn Hill NP QLD, Bitter Springs NT and Edith Falls NT. Kakadu was nice, especially around Yellow Waters, but it's just so dry there at the moment and the flys would send you crazy!
I will be pushing off from Darwin next week, heading back down south to Adelaide and then over the Nullabor to WA. Really looking forward to getting to the west coast. Can't wait to have a swim in the ocean again!
